Output 81f2b71b0932232c63c82089569fcf9219b7710f5b26f6ee8bc7b4f45c6d4da0:11

value
33024884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c589037ecaa72a4bcbd8e9d7a53f108184948b1 OP_EQUAL
address
MLhEvmy6xLMKV9YL9YxHQejhhEQeZibXyN
transaction
81f2b71b0932232c63c82089569fcf9219b7710f5b26f6ee8bc7b4f45c6d4da0
spent
true